HON. CHARLES I. BARKER
MR. SPEAKER: Your committee appointed to draw and present resolutions relative to the death of Hon. Charles I. Barker of Burlington, Iowa, beg leave to submit the following:
WHEREAS, The Hon. Charles I. Barker, a member of the Twenty-fifth General Assembly, departed this life on the 6th day of October, 1904, at Burlington, Iowa, and
WHEREAS, The life and character of the deceased were such as to command our respect and esteem, and his services to his State, his Country and his City, were such as to command the respect and gratitude of his fellow citizens; therefore be it
Resolved, That in his death the State has lost a citizen who was honorable and upright, and one whose valuable services were noted for the patriotism and fidelity to all public interests.
Resolved, That these resolutions be entered in the Journal of the House, and the chief clerk of the House be instructed to present an engrossed copy thereof, to the Burlington Gazette and one to the bereaved family.
HENRY RITTER,
C. C. COLCLO,
D. C. MOTT,
Committee.
Adopted.
